Dave, Daniel
A fix for a DMA API change from Christoph Hellwig for vmwgfx, and
Two stable fixes for regressions in the vmwgfx driver
The following changes since commit f0e7ce1eef5854584dfb59b3824a67edee37580f:
Merge tag 'drm-msm-fixes-2019-01-24' of git://people.freedesktop.org/~robclark/linux into drm-fixes (2019-01-25 07:45:00 +1000)
are available in the Git repository at:
git://people.freedesktop.org/~thomash/linux tags/vmwgfx-fixes-5.0-190130
for you to fetch changes up to 46984feb928ade4af744eb4e4cc8b242ffaf14e3:
drm/vmwgfx: Also check for crtc status while checking for DU active (2019-01-29 13:57:56 +0100)
----------------------------------------------------------------
Pull request of 190130
----------------------------------------------------------------
Christoph Hellwig (4):
drm/vmwgfx: remove CONFIG_X86 ifdefs
drm/vmwgfx: remove CONFIG_INTEL_IOMMU ifdefs v2
drm/vmwgfx: fix the check when to use dma_alloc_coherent
drm/vmwgfx: unwind spaghetti code in vmw_dma_select_mode
Deepak Rawat (1):
drm/vmwgfx: Also check for crtc status while checking for DU active
Thomas Hellstrom (1):
drm/vmwgfx: Fix an uninitialized fence handle value
drivers/gpu/drm/vmwgfx/vmwgfx_drv.c | 55 +++++++------------------------------
drivers/gpu/drm/vmwgfx/vmwgfx_kms.c | 6 ++--
2 files changed, 13 insertions(+), 48 deletions(-)
